*Blaming the Hip Hop industry for dumbing down a generation of African American youth, a NC minister is demanding “Rapper-ations”  this Black History Month.

Minister Paul Scott, founder of the  Durham NC  based Messianic Afrikan Nation says that not only has the industry destroyed the contributions of the heroes of Black History, it has also destroyed our Black future by making it cool to be dumb.

“We used to be Poor Righteous Teachers. now we are “Young Thugs, ” says Scott.

Scott is demanding reparations from the music industry in the form of scholarships, donations to youth programs and historically black colleges. He is also asking Hip Hop artists, like Young Thug to repair the damage done by rap music by encouraging their fans to study black history this Black History Month.

We have let today’s rap music turn our “Sister Souljahs” into “Stacey Dashes.” he says.

Min. Paul Scott is a community activist who gives out free black history books on the streets of his community. He has also launched a campaign to make Black History classes mandatory in North Carolina.
